Editorial Reviews:
|
The day-to-day dealings of life as a cystic fibrosis patient are described through a series of flashbacks to a time when the author was an 18-year-old volunteer at cystic fibrosis overnight camp. From diagnosis to death, this book leaves no aspect of CF untold as it includes a description of the illness; a comprehensive discussion of who gets the disease and why; an explanation of the procedures involved in diagnosing the disease; coverage of the arduous daily therapies involved in maintaining the life of a person with cystic fibrosis; and, now that people who have CF are living longer because of available therapies, the new challenges of dealing with CF-related diabetes as well as making decisions regarding lung transplants are all covered.

Customer Rating:      Summary: For Those Who Need To Know Comment: Cystic fibrosis is much more than a chronic, life-threatening medical condition. The disease is bad enough, but it has far-reaching effects on many parts of the body. Those who suffer with it are condemned to a very complicated way of life they'd never voluntarily choose. Friends, family and loved ones are affected by it too.
Melanie Apel deftly guides the reader to an understanding of many facets of CF: biological, emotional, psychological and social. Her point of view as insider/outsider/guide is successful and she has both empathy and knowledge based on her experience and training. She's employed a good voice for the target audience, too--it's direct and doesn't sidestep issues, there are lots of real-life stories, and when she explains the science end of things she doesn't talk down to readers or become too overwhelmingly complicated.
The last part of the book is necessarily sad--most with the disease eventually succumb to it, but the book ends on a hopeful and courageous note. If it had been around when I was a teenager, I would have wanted to read it. I'm glad it's around now that I'm an adult. I learned a lot.
